Spells Of Enchantment by Jack Zipes
The Wondrous Fairy Tales of Western Culture
The book is a comprehensive anthology that explores the rich and diverse world of fairy tales, presenting a wide array of stories from different cultures and time periods. It delves into the transformative power of these tales, examining how they reflect societal values, fears, and desires. The collection includes both classic and lesser-known stories, offering insightful commentary on their historical and cultural contexts. Through this exploration, the book highlights the enduring appeal and significance of fairy tales in shaping human imagination and understanding.
